Anorexia Nervosa
An eating disorder characterized by self-imposed starvation and excessive weight loss due to an intense fear of gaining weight.
Underweight
A condition characterized by having a body weight that is considered too low to be healthy, often defined by a Body Mass Index (BMI) below 18.5.
Menstruating
The monthly biological process in females of reproductive age where the lining of the uterus sheds, accompanied by bleeding, marking a normal reproductive cycle.
Generalized Anxiety Disorder
Disorder in which a person has feelings of dread and impending doom along with physical symptoms of stress, which lasts 6 months or more.
